Writers rooms are opening this week for Wolf Entertainment and Universal Television’s three Chicago dramas for NBC, three FBI dramas for CBS as well as NBC’s Law & Order and Law & Order: SVU.
In light of Wolf veteran Derek Haas’ departure last spring as FBI: International showrunner and Chicago Fire co-showrunner, both series have set successors.
Andrea Newman, formerly co-showrunner alongside Haas, will be sole showrunner for Chicago Fire‘s upcoming 12th season. Another Wolf vet, Chicago P.D.
co-creator and former showrunner Matt Olmstead, will serve as showrunner on Season 3 of FBI: International, which he originally had joined as executive producer.
